# Docker & CI/CD Setup Summary
This document summarizes all Docker and CI/CD files created for sexy.pivoine.art.
## Files Created
### Docker Files
1. **`Dockerfile`** (root)
- Multi-stage build (base → builder → runner)
- Rust toolchain installation for WASM builds
- Optimized layer caching
- Non-root user for security
- Health checks included
2. **`.dockerignore`** (root)
- Excludes unnecessary files from build context
- Optimizes build performance
3. **`docker-compose.production.yml`** (root)
- Production orchestration
- Pre-configured to use GHCR images
- Resource limits and health checks
- Environment variable management
4. **`.env.production.example`** (root)
- Template for all environment variables
- Documented with examples
### Build Scripts
5. **`build.sh`** (root)
- Convenience script for building images
- Supports tags, platforms, and pushing
- Executable (`chmod +x`)
### Documentation
6. **`DOCKER.md`** (root)
- Comprehensive Docker deployment guide
- Building, running, troubleshooting
- Production best practices
- Updated with GHCR information
7. **`QUICKSTART.md`** (root)
- 5-minute quick start guide
- Docker Run and Docker Compose examples
- Common commands reference
8. **`README.md`** (root) - **UPDATED**
- Added Docker quick start
- Added CI/CD badges
- Added documentation links
9. **`CLAUDE.md`** (root) - **UPDATED**
- Added Docker deployment section
- Referenced DOCKER.md
### GitHub Actions Workflows
10. **`.github/workflows/docker-build-push.yml`**
- Builds and pushes to `ghcr.io/valknarxxx/sexy`
- Multi-platform (AMD64 + ARM64)
- Smart tagging (latest, semver, branch, SHA)
- Triggers: push to main/develop, tags, PRs, manual
- BuildKit cache for faster builds
11. **`.github/workflows/docker-scan.yml`**
- Daily security scans with Trivy
- Reports to GitHub Security tab
- Scans CRITICAL and HIGH vulnerabilities
- Triggers: schedule, push to main, tags, manual
12. **`.github/workflows/cleanup-images.yml`**
- Weekly cleanup of old images
- Keeps last 10 versions (configurable)
- Deletes untagged images
- Triggers: schedule, manual
13. **`.github/workflows/README.md`**
- Comprehensive workflow documentation
- Setup requirements
- Usage examples
- Troubleshooting guide
14. **`.github/DOCKER_SETUP.md`** (this file)
- Summary of all Docker/CI files
- Quick reference
## Quick Reference
### Image Registry
- **Registry:** GitHub Container Registry (GHCR)
- **Image Name:** `ghcr.io/valknarxxx/sexy`
- **Tags:**
- `latest` - Latest from main branch
- `v1.0.0` - Semantic versions
- `develop` - Latest from develop branch
- `main-abc123` - Commit-specific
### Pull & Run
```bash
# Pull latest
docker pull ghcr.io/valknarxxx/sexy:latest
# Run
docker run -d -p 3000:3000 --env-file .env.production ghcr.io/valknarxxx/sexy:latest
# Or use docker-compose
docker-compose -f docker-compose.production.yml up -d
```
### Build Locally
```bash
# Using script
./build.sh
# Manual
docker build -t sexy.pivoine.art:latest .
# Multi-platform
docker buildx build --platform linux/amd64,linux/arm64 -t sexy.pivoine.art:latest .
```
### Trigger CI/CD
```bash
# Build and push 'latest'
git push origin main
# Build and push version tags
git tag v1.0.0
git push origin v1.0.0
# PR builds (test only, doesn't push)
git push origin feature/branch
# Create PR on GitHub
```
## Key Features
### Security
- ✅ Non-root user in container
- ✅ Minimal base image (node:20.19.1-slim)
- ✅ Daily vulnerability scans
- ✅ Security reports in GitHub Security tab
### Performance
- ✅ Multi-stage builds for smaller images
- ✅ BuildKit cache for faster builds
- ✅ Production-only dependencies
- ✅ Optimized layer caching
### Reliability
- ✅ Health checks built-in
- ✅ dumb-init for proper signal handling
- ✅ Resource limits configurable
- ✅ Auto-restart on failure
### Automation
- ✅ Automatic builds on push/tag
- ✅ Multi-platform support
- ✅ Smart semantic versioning
- ✅ Weekly image cleanup
## Workflow Triggers Summary
| Workflow | Push Main | Push Develop | Tags | PR | Schedule | Manual |
|----------|-----------|--------------|------|----|----------|--------|
| Build & Push |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 (no push) | ❌ | ✅ |
| Security Scan | ✅ | ❌ | ✅ | ❌ | Daily 2AM | ✅ |
| Cleanup | ❌ | ❌ | ❌ | ❌ | Weekly Sun 3AM | ✅ |
## Environment Variables
### Required
- `PUBLIC_API_URL` - Directus API endpoint
- `PUBLIC_URL` - Frontend URL
### Optional
- `PUBLIC_UMAMI_ID` - Analytics
- `LETTERSPACE_API_URL` - Newsletter API
- `LETTERSPACE_API_KEY` - Newsletter key
- `LETTERSPACE_LIST_ID` - Mailing list ID
See `.env.production.example` for full reference.

## Troubleshooting
### Common Issues
1. **Build takes too long**
- Multi-platform builds take 30-45 minutes (normal)
- Consider using self-hosted runners
2. **Permission denied on push**
- Check Settings → Actions → General → Workflow permissions
- Enable "Read and write permissions"
3. **Image not found**
- For private repos, login to GHCR first
- Check package exists at github.com/valknarxxx?tab=packages
4. **Container exits immediately**
- Check logs: `docker logs <container>`
- Verify environment variables
- Ensure port 3000 is not in use
